NSE Unlisted Shares: Current Information
Major Trigger: IPO Update
In 2026, the NSE IPO process is moving forward.
After protracted regulatory hurdles, the exchange is pushing toward listing.
With no new capital issue, the IPO is anticipated to be an Offer for Sale (OFS).
Expected timeline: 6–9 months (2026) if approvals continue as planned.
For unlisted investors, this continues to be the largest value-unlocking event.
Trend of Unlisted Share Price
The current market range is between ₹1,900 to ₹2,000 per share.
Because of IPO expectations, prices are heavily influenced by mood.
Strong investor demand is demonstrated by earlier highs at ₹2,400+.

Status Regulation
Previous problems (co-location case) caused an earlier IPO delay.
Now that the issue has been mostly rectified, listing prospects have improved.
2026 will see a more favorable regulatory climate.
